Title: Walther Grommes: Innovator in Workpiece Machining
Introduction
Walther Grommes is a notable inventor based in Munich,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of machining, particularly through his innovative methods for workpiece processing. With a total of 2 patents, Grommes has established himself as a key figure in his industry.
Latest Patents
Grommes' latest patents focus on a method for machining a workpiece on a workpiece support. This method involves attaching a workpiece to a workpiece support using joining means. The workpiece and the workpiece support are joined together by an annular joining means. The composite produced is then machined, and the machined workpiece is separated from the workpiece support.
